The Evolution of the Luxury Key
In the early days of automobile luxury, a physical key with an unique cut was the height of security. Today, luxury lorries utilize distance sensing units, biometric data, and encrypted transponder signals. The primary goal is twofold: convenience for the chauffeur and an overwhelming barrier for possible burglars.

Luxury makers invest millions into exclusive immobilizer systems. For example, BMW uses the CAS (Car Access System) and more recent BDC (Body Domain Controller) modules, while Mercedes-Benz makes use of the EIS (Electronic Ignition Switch) and the highly safe and secure FBS4 procedure. These systems make sure that the automobile will not start unless a particular, digitally signed handshake occurs in between the key and the onboard computer system.

1. Rolling Code Encryption
Luxury secrets do not send the same signal two times. Each time a button is pushed or a distance sensor is triggered, the key and the car produce a new code based on a shared algorithm. If the synchronization is lost or the programming is performed improperly, the vehicle may go into a "lockdown" mode, requiring a complete reset of the security module.
2. Deep Integration with Vehicle Systems
In a high-end vehicle, the key is often connected to the driver's profile. Programming a new key includes more than just beginning the engine; it consists of syncing memory seat positions, environment control choices, side mirror angles, and even radio presets.
3. Restricted Dealer Databases
Lots of high-end manufacturers limit access to key codes and programming software to licensed dealers or certified security experts. This "closed-loop" system avoids unauthorized individuals from easily replicating secrets however adds a layer of problem when a replacement is required.

When a specialist deals with key programming for a luxury car, they follow an extensive procedure to guarantee the car's stability stays intact.
Stage 1: Authentication and Verification
Before any digital work starts, the specialist should verify the ownership of the vehicle. This is a critical security step to avoid the cloning of keys for theft. They will usually inspect the VIN (Vehicle Identification Number) versus the producer's database.
Phase 2: Diagnostic Connection
The technician links a high-end diagnostic tablet-- such as those produced by Autel, Xhorse, or brand-specific factory tools-- to the lorry's OBD-II port. In some severe "all secrets lost" circumstances for brand names like Audi or Mercedes, the specialist might require to remove the security module (EEPROM) and check out the information directly from the chip.
Phase 3: Clearing Old Data
If a key has actually been lost or taken, it is vital to "de-program" the old key. The technician accesses the vehicle's immobilizer memory and erases the lost key's digital footprint, ensuring it can no longer be utilized to start or go into the car.
Stage 4: Programming the New Transponder
The new key is positioned in an unique programming slot or held near the induction coil. The software then uploads the special encrypted ID to the car's ECU (Engine Control Unit). This procedure may take anywhere from 15 minutes to over an hour, depending on the complexity of the car's firewall.

Frequently Asked Questions (FAQ)
Q: Can any locksmith professional program a key for a Lamborghini or Ferrari?A: No. A lot of standard locksmith professionals do not have the costly, brand-specific software licenses or the specialized EEPROM reading tools needed for Italian exotics. You usually need an expert high-end vehicle locksmith professional or a dealer.

Q: Why is it a lot more expensive to program a high-end key compared to a basic car?A: The expense is driven by the high price of OEM hardware, the membership costs for manufacturer-level software application, and the innovative training needed to navigate intricate security firewall softwares.

Q: How long does the programming procedure take?A: In many cases, it takes in between 30 and 90 minutes. However, if the lorry needs a "server-online" sync with a factory in Germany or Japan, it might take longer depending upon server accessibility.

Q: Can I program an utilized key from another car to my luxury car?A: Generally, no. The majority of high-end keys are "locked" to the initial VIN once configured. While some professionals can "unlock" or "restore" specific Mercedes or BMW keys, it is typically more reputable to utilize a brand-new, virgin transponder.

Q: What is a "Relay Attack," and can new secrets prevent it?A: A relay attack is when burglars use a booster to pick up a key's signal from inside a house and beam it to the car. Numerous new high-end secrets (like those from Land Rover and BMW) now feature motion sensing units that put the key to "sleep" when it hasn't moved for a few minutes, neutralizing this danger.
